The global residential elevator market has experienced a significant structural transformation over the last decade. Once considered an exclusive luxury item for high-end mansions, at-home elevator installations are rapidly becoming mainstream vertical mobility solutions. This shifts is propelled by three primary macro-drivers: aging demographics across key markets, universal design trends in architectural blueprints, and engineering advancements that reduce structural footprint and energy requirements.
By 2030, one in six people globally will be aged 60 or older. Home mobility solutions ensure multi-generational safety and age-in-place readiness without relocations.
New-generation residential traction elevators consume up to 50% less energy than outdated hydraulic designs, utilizing intelligent variable frequency technology.
Integrating premium home lifts raises building valuation and broadens buyer appeal, offering functional luxury for modern villas.
Modern residential elevators must comply with strict national and global safety norms. The European Standard EN 81-20/50 and safety codes for lifts like EN 81-41 define structural guidelines, clearance spaces, and fail-safe electronics for home lift manufacturing. China has emerged as the global powerhouse for these systems, representing over 70% of worldwide elevator components manufacture. Chinese factories leverage highly integrated industrial supply chains, executing high-precision CNC laser cutting, robot welding, and advanced testing setups to guarantee strict compliance with EN standards.

An overview of drive architectures, structural setups, and electronic designs.
Utilizing permanent magnet synchronous motor (PMSM) systems, this setup removes the need for traditional gear oil, achieving lower energy consumption, noise levels under 48dB, and highly smooth start/stop accelerations.
Variable Voltage Variable Frequency (VVVF) closed-loop control guarantees adaptive torque outputs. Our door operators sense obstacle resistances and dynamically recalibrate speed profiles to ensure absolute hand/body protection.
In the event of a primary power failure, the integrated battery-operated ARD controller routes power to the motor and controls. The lift moves safely to the nearest landing zone and opens the doors automatically.
Modern home lifts are shifting toward smarter, safer, and more space-efficient architectures. The transition from Machine Room (MR) to Machine Roomless (MRL) designs allows builders to optimize structural overhead spaces, requiring zero structural protrusions through roof tiles. We are also integrating IoT monitoring hubs that track system starts, load balances, and door cycles in real time. This predictive data identifies maintenance requirements before components wear down, optimizing uptime for home lift owners worldwide.
